Deep TMS

Transcranial magnetic stimulation (TMS) may be able to help in the event that psychotherapy and medication fail to improve your anxiety depression. TMS utilizes magnetic pulses to alter nerve cell activity in certain areas of the brain that control mood. A doctor will place an electromagnets near your skull and send pulses through your skin to stimulate nerve cells and alter the way the brain functions.

The most recent naturalistic study on Deep TMS showed that the treatment significantly improved the comorbid MDD and anxiety symptoms. Unlike other treatments such as electroconvulsive treatment (ECT), results did not differ based on the baseline anxiety levels. This indicates that TMS is efficient regardless of a patient's mental health. It works equally well for those suffering from high and low anxiety.

In the most recent study, patients were treated to 20 Deep TMS sessions at one of 21 clinics across the US. Researchers discovered that by using scales for rating administered by physicians and self-reporting of patients, they were able compare the remission and response rates at 20 and 30 sessions. The remission rates for patients suffering from anxiety in elderly treatment (Read A lot more) disorders that are comorbid were higher, at 66%.

TMS sessions last between 30 and 60 minutes The patient remains awake during the procedure. The procedure what is the best anxiety treatment non-invasive and safe, with no requirement for sedation or other type of anesthesia. Patients can take a car to and from their appointments, and there are no lasting effects after each treatment.

The most frequent side effect of TMS is moderate to mild bruising and patients are able to resume normal activities right after their appointment. There is no need for a recovery period, and each session can be scheduled to coincide with your normal routine. Additionally there is no chance of a seizure and the procedure does not interfere with any medications that you might be taking.

Medication

Many people find they experience periods of anxiety or a low mood. If these symptoms are severe and affect your daily life, they should be evaluated.

The doctor will inquire about your medical history, and then perform an examination to establish an assessment. They will also inquire with the person about their mood and how they feel. The doctor might suggest a variety of psychotherapy methods that can help to reduce generalized anxiety treatment. They could include cognitive behavioral therapy, where the patient learns to recognize harmful behaviors and thoughts and replace them with more productive ones. Exposure therapy could be helpful, where the person is repeatedly exposed to stressful situations in order to become accustomed to them and reduce the severity of their symptoms.

There are a variety of drugs that are effective in treating anxiety. Sel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s) include citalopram, escitalopram, and fluoxetine are frequently employed to treat anxiety. SNRIs such as venlafaxine and sertraline, are also useful as are tricyclic antidepressants such as mirtazapine and imipramine. As an alternative, the benzodiazepine class of anxiolytics like diazepam or lorazepam can be employed in short-term treatment. However, benzodiazepines cause sedation, interfere with cognitive functions and are more prone to abuse. Buspirone is a member of the nonbenzodiazepine anxiolytics class known as azapirone. It is more effective in long-term treatment and has a lower chance for abuse than benzodiazepines.

Depression and anxiety disorders frequently occur in tandem and it is difficult to determine which one is the cause of the most stress. In such cases, it is possible to treat both conditions simultaneously. The newest antidepressants, such as esketamine, have shown promise for treating both of these conditions. It is possible that future research could lead to more effective treatments.

It is crucial to adhere to your treatment program throughout the duration. A lack of follow up could result in the recurrence of symptoms, and even a repeat. Joining a support network can be beneficial as people with the same condition will be able to share their experiences and demonstrate compassion. Some groups can even provide strategies for managing stress, like meditation or exercise.

Psychotherapy

Talk therapy or psychotherapy can reduce anxiety and depression symptoms. There are many types of therapy that are effective, including c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) as well as interpersonal therapy, problem-solving therapy and exposure therapy. In some instances, medication can be utilized in combination with these therapies to reduce depression and anxiety. Antidepressant medicines, like sel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s), serotonin norepinephrine reuptake inhibitors (SNRIs) and tricyclic antidepressants (TCAs) are usually effective in relieving both depression and anxiety. Mood stabilizers can be useful in reducing anxiety and depression.

Behavioral therapies are particularly useful for treating anxiety and depression as they aim to change an unhealthy behavior. CBT teaches patients to replace negative feelings and thoughts with more positive ones. Exposure therapy is one type of CBT which involves confronting difficult situations and fears in order to develop healthier strategies to cope with anxiety-provoking events. The therapy of problem-solving and interpersonal can be helpful in addressing issues that could contribute to anxiety or depression, such as poor ability to cope and difficulties in forming healthy relationships.

Other treatments that are effective in the treatment of comorbid depression and anxiety include mindfulness meditation, relaxation techniques, as well as social support groups. Finding a therapist you can have a relationship is essential to the success of your therapy. People can try different types of therapy to discover the one that works for them.

A specialized treatment that can be used for anxiety and depression is Deep Transcranial Magnetic Stimulation (Deep TMS). This non-invasive, brain-based treatment utilizes magnetic coils to target regions of the brain that are associated with anxiety and depression. The procedure is safe and well-tolerated, with a few minor to moderate adverse effects. The 20-minute sessions can be integrated into a daily schedule and no anesthesia is required or recovery time required.

Lifestyle Changes

Some people be overwhelmed by the symptoms of anxiety and depression, however, they can improve their mood. One option is to get enough sleep. Exercise regularly and eat healthy food are also good alternatives. Support from family and friends is also important. You can seek assistance by joining a depression or anxiety support group or visiting a therapist who will teach them techniques for reducing stress.

The first step is to speak with an expert. They'll usually inquire about the patient's symptoms and may also conduct urine or blood tests. Certain medical conditions like thyroid issues can affect how someone feels. They should also be aware if the patient has had any previous mental health problems.

Psychotherapy or talk therapy has been proven effective for treating depression and anxiety. There are a variety of therapy that have been proven to be effective, including cognitive-behavioral (CBT) as well as problem-solving therapy, and interpersonal therapy. Some studies have found that acupuncture, CAM therapies such as massage, naturopathy and the use of naturopathy can help reduce anxiety and depressive disorders.

Anxiety and depression can cause people to withdraw from activities they enjoy. But, avoiding social interactions can cause loneliness and loneliness. It is essential to remember, too, that symptoms of anxiety and depression are not a sign of a bad character. Instead, they are a sign that you are struggling.

It is important to change your daily routine when trying to conquer depression and anxiety. A schedule will make you feel more in control of your day-to-day life. Sleeping enough, exercising regularly, and eating healthy are all helpful in alleviating the symptoms of anxious depression. You can also engage in activities that help reduce stress such as yoga or meditation. Additionally, you should avoid drinking alcohol and using illegal drugs since they can aggravate your symptoms.
